When a Woman Is Just a Woman
When a woman is just a woman
It is unclear as whom she began
Is she your wife, sister or mother?
Boss, or friend or sometime lover
Is she the angel/demon of the night?
Does she hold the purse strings tight?
Is she the one who sheds a tear?
Then wipes it quickly before you hear
Is she the one who kisses your knee?
Pushes you to be, all you can be
It is clear she meets the needs of man.
When a woman is just a woman
